【交叉编译tcpdump】
作者:互联网
交叉编译tcpdump
交叉编译tcpdump
由于我的板卡里没有tcpdump,但是使用中需要抓包分析,于是交叉编译了下tcpdump,记录下过程。
环境准备
编译环境:20.04.1-Ubuntu
交叉编译工具:aarch64-himix100-linux
源码:libpcap-1.8.1.tar.gz tcpdump-4.9.1.tar.gz
编译libcap
./configure --host=aarch64-himix100-linux --prefix=/root/work/ryk/tcpdump/bulid --with-pcap=linux
make
make install
编译tcpdump
./configure --prefix=/root/work/ryk/tcpdump/bulid --host=aarch64-himix100-linux --with-pcap=linux
make
##测试
拷贝到板卡中,抓一下包测试。
./tcpdump -i eth0 host 8.0.0.121 -w 121.cap
标签:交叉,--,编译,linux,tcpdump,aarch64 来源: https://blog.csdn.net/miaopasi_QAQ/article/details/123608626